To set up the Clarke 4003620 COB10T 230V LED Worklight, first ensure it is unplugged. Attach the stand to the base using the provided screws. Adjust the angle of the light to your preference before plugging it into a 230V outlet.
Check the power connection and ensure the outlet is functional. Inspect the power cable for any visible damage. If the problem persists, consult the user manual for troubleshooting or contact Clarke customer support.
Yes, the Clarke 4003620 COB10T is suitable for outdoor use, but ensure it is not exposed to direct rain or submerged in water as it is not waterproof.
Regularly clean the light with a dry cloth to remove dust and debris. Inspect the power cable for any signs of wear and store the worklight in a dry place when not in use.
The LED bulbs in the Clarke 4003620 COB10T worklight typically have a lifespan of up to 30,000 hours, depending on usage and environmental conditions.
This model does not feature adjustable brightness. It is designed to provide consistent illumination at a fixed brightness level.
If the worklight overheats, turn it off immediately and allow it to cool down. Ensure it is placed in a well-ventilated area and not covered. If overheating continues, contact customer support.
Yes, the Clarke 4003620 COB10T LED worklight is energy efficient, consuming less power compared to traditional halogen lights while providing high-quality illumination.
No, the LED bulbs in the Clarke 4003620 are not user-replaceable. If the LEDs fail, you may need to replace the entire unit.
Ensure the worklight is placed on a stable surface. Avoid looking directly into the light when it is on. Do not touch the light while it is hot and always unplug before maintenance.
